Buying tips
- Prioritize replaceable parts.
- Look for anti-scratch treatments.
- Consider bundling with a small accessory micro‑product (case, strap) to increase perceived value when reselling.
Conclusion
For bargain shoppers seeking durability, pick frames with replaceable parts and a good warranty. The PatriotShield is solid, but cheaper alternatives with modular parts can be a better value for casual fans.
